The NCV7361A consists of a low drop voltage regulator, 5.0 V/50 mA and a LIN bus transceiver.
The LIN transceiver is sui t a bl e for LIN bus syst e m s com pa t i bl e to “LIN−Protocol Specification” Rev. 1.3, 2.0 and SAE J2602.
The combination of voltage regulator and bus transceiver make it ideal for a powerful and inexpensive cost effective slave node in a LIN Bus system.
